Output 3ddae2b659bbb455e4a267fa04e9dc4f28ef3a6ad41b7519448e99f8bf526293:1

value
112398039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e28b6e49015f1fd05f6d2ce6e6004f4e194e64 OP_EQUALVERIFY OP_CHECKSIG
address
LMQFCDuxQhN1LVotwzTJNcayFSoYzwJKjX
transaction
3ddae2b659bbb455e4a267fa04e9dc4f28ef3a6ad41b7519448e99f8bf526293
spent
true